Fusing the rhythmically-charged beats of afro-house with compelling marimba melodies and the uplifiting indie vocals of Okapii's Alex Rita, Eventually marks the beginning of a whole new musical journey for the globetrotting producer, musician and Enchufada head honcho Branko. After recording the track at Red Bull Music Academy Studios Copenhagen, the overwhelming response it got inspired him to take a whole new approach to his work that would define the next few months of his life. Deciding to record a whole album while travelling across the world, he connected with local artists from some of the most exciting music scenes around, and recording the voices, beats and samples that will eventually become his highly-anticipated debut album 'Atlas'.

NYC-based producer Tony Quattro jumps in on the remix, expertly distilling the original's essence and turning it into a dancefloor-focused anthem fit to rock the world's most tropical DJ sets, by introducing some extra bass weight and heavy ballroom percussion. This only the first stop on an epic journey that has taken Branko to New York, Amsterdam, Cape Town and São Paulo on a mission to show how global this Global Club Music scene can truly get, while simultaneously raising the bar for all dance music with a cultural edge.
